V2Ray ID 生成完全指南

什么是 V2Ray ID?

V2Ray ID 是 V2Ray 代理工具中的一个重要概念,用于标识和连接不同的用户和节点。它通常由 UUID(通用唯一识别码)组成,确保每个用户都有独特的标识。

为何需要 V2Ray ID?

生成 V2Ray ID 的原因包括:

  • 安全性:每个 ID 都是唯一的,能够防止恶意用户的攻击。
  • 多用户支持:可以为不同的用户分配不同的 ID,便于管理。
  • 配置简便:通过 ID 进行配置,使得节点连接更加方便。

V2Ray ID 的生成方式

使用命令行生成 V2Ray ID

使用命令行是生成 V2Ray ID 的一种快速且有效的方法,下面是步骤:

  1. 打开命令行工具:可以使用 Windows 的 CMD 或者 Linux/Mac 的终端。

  2. 输入命令:使用以下命令生成 UUID: bash uuidgen

    或者使用 Python 脚本: python import uuid print(uuid.uuid4())

  3. 记录生成的 UUID:将生成的 UUID 记录下来,方便后续配置使用。

使用在线工具生成 V2Ray ID

如果您不习惯命令行操作,可以使用在线工具生成 UUID,以下是步骤:

  1. 访问在线 UUID 生成器:例如 UUID Generator
  2. 点击生成按钮:在页面中找到“生成”按钮,点击后将自动生成一个 UUID。
  3. 复制生成的 UUID:将生成的 UUID 复制下来,作为 V2Ray ID 使用。

V2Ray ID 的使用场景

V2Ray ID 在多个场景中都能派上用场,具体包括:

  • 个人使用:个人用户在配置 V2Ray 客户端时需要使用 ID 连接到服务端。
  • 团队协作:在团队环境中,管理员可以为每位成员分配不同的 ID,方便权限管理。
  • 动态变更:对于需要频繁更改 ID 的应用场景,通过脚本自动生成 ID 可提升工作效率。

V2Ray ID 的最佳实践

  • 定期更换 ID:为提高安全性,建议定期更换 V2Ray ID。
  • 使用复杂的 ID:确保生成的 UUID 具有足够的复杂性,避免被猜测。
  • 备份 ID:将生成的 ID 备份,以防丢失。

常见问题解答(FAQ)

如何查看我生成的 V2Ray ID?

您可以通过在命令行中使用 uuidgen 命令,或者查看您使用的在线工具记录的 UUID。通常生成的 ID 在使用时会被复制到配置文件中,您也可以直接在文件中查看。

V2Ray ID 是否可以重复使用?

理论上,UUID 的设计是为了确保唯一性,因此每次生成都不应重复使用。不过,如果您使用的是较短的字符串,可能会存在重复的风险,建议使用完整的 UUID。

如何将 V2Ray ID 配置到客户端?

将生成的 V2Ray ID 放入配置文件中的对应字段,具体步骤如下:

  1. 打开 V2Ray 客户端配置文件(如 config.json)。
  2. 找到对应的 id 字段。
  3. 将生成的 UUID 复制到 id 字段后。
  4. 保存配置文件并重启客户端。

V2Ray ID 生成失败怎么办?

如果在生成 ID 时遇到问题,可以尝试以下步骤:

  • 确保您的命令行工具或在线生成器可以正常访问。
  • 重启您的计算机或网络设备,尝试再次生成。
  • 检查是否有权限问题,确保您有权限使用命令行工具。

总结

本文介绍了 V2Ray ID 的定义、生成方法及最佳实践,并解答了一些常见问题。希望对您在使用 V2Ray 时有所帮助。

正文完